Transaction ec6f7b082afce022e84b3b0773c6c4aa2c904a2fdf2496074807981cf8ac1953
1 Input
1 Output
-
ec6f7b082afce022e84b3b0773c6c4aa2c904a2fdf2496074807981cf8ac1953:0
- value
- 10432068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 403f9a1ec610013cd93d8aa00d442fa47e69d39c OP_EQUAL
- address
- 37YjMy58YuGDudRkVtL2gpubQBes9LkFYw